OverviewEagle View, the leader in aerial imagery, is hiring an Aviation Maintenance Technician II (AMT II) for our team. The AMT II will support large‑scale aerial survey operations. Primary responsibilities will include interfacing with other AMTs, establishing best practices for aircraft and camera system maintenance, and performing sign‑offs for camera maintenance and installations in accordance with FAA regulations. The candidate will also be responsible for inspections, repairs, modifications, periodic maintenance, and service of aircraft within the limits of the employee's Federal Aviation Association (FAA) Airframe & Power Plant (A&P) certificate with respect to Part 91 operations.
Responsibilities- Work with a team of AMTs, or individually when necessary, to maintain a fleet of piston‑engine aircraft in accordance with 14 CFR Part 91 operations.
- Work with a team of AMTs, or individually when necessary, to repair aircraft accessory parts.
- Perform tasks associated with annual inspections, routine periodic inspections and maintenance, and non‑routine inspections and maintenance of PFA aircraft.
- Troubleshoot and assess cause and effect of discrepancies, abnormalities, or safety concerns and report findings to the AMT Site Lead or AMT Team Lead if applicable. Complete appropriate reports and documentation as required.
- Remove and install camera equipment per EV, PFA, and FAA guidelines and requirements.
- Complete all documentation of aircraft work in accordance with PFA, EV, and FAA policies and standards.
